The fifth annual novice gymnastic meet held in the Hemenway Gymnasium last evening, was won by C. Mashima '12, who scored 320 out of a possible 450 points and gained possession of the cup for general excellence given by Dr. D. A. Sargent, director of the Gymnasium. R. L. Forbush '13 was second, and R. B. Whitelaw '11, third. The judges were Mr. C. Cameron, instructor of gymnastics at the Brookline Municipal Gymnasium, Mr. C. L. Schrader, University instructor of gymnastics, and W. C. Bennett '08.
The results were:
Horizontal bar--C. Mashima '12, first; R. L. Forbush '13, second; H. Bush-Brown '11, third.
Side Horse--C. Mashima '12, first; K. H. Barnard '11, second; R. L. Forbush '13, third.
Flying rings--R. B. Whitelaw '11, first; C. Mashima '12, second; R. L. Forbush '13, third.
Club Swinging--R. L. Forbush '13, first; H. Bush-Brown '11, second.
Tumbling--R. L. Forbush '13, first; C. Mashima '12, second; H. Bush-Brown '11, third.
Parallel bars -- R. B. Whitelaw '11, first; R. L. Forbush '13, second; C. Mashima '12, third.
